
一.5·Android/Java
文章平均质量分 61
niyufeng
这个作者很懒,什么都没留下…
展开
-
android摄像头,linux摄像头设备,编程
Google关键字搜索:android摄像头 编程第三十六讲:Android手机摄像头编程入门http://android.yaohuiji.com/archives/2502原创 2012-02-17 00:16:11 · 1144 阅读 · 0 评论 -
CyanogenMod精简手记
http://www.redini.net/iTech/69/http://yourtion.com/ 自CyanogenMod 7.0放出后使用的这段时间来说,总体不错。毕竟是很多人在一起努力,CyanogenMod还是比Oxygen Gingerbread 2.01要优秀一些,实在话。CyanogenMod到底有多好,还真没有人能下个定论。 国内做的比较好的M转载 2012-11-13 01:56:50 · 4930 阅读 · 0 评论 -
Android2.2,2.3,4.0 中如何使用GPU硬件加速原理 和游戏3D性能的提升
http://bbs.dospy.com/viewthread.php?tid=15445547&bbsid=648http://blog.youkuaiyun.com/martingang/article/details/8142120http://hi.baidu.com/aokikyon/item/70e973d043bad21c21e2500d资料来自网络收集。原创 2012-11-09 14:47:24 · 1746 阅读 · 0 评论 -
ARM架构处理器
参看:《ARM架构应用处理器与x86处理器》 http://cn.engadget.com/2011/05/25/a-little-different-between-arm-and-x86/《从ARM9到A15 手机处理器架构进化历程》 http://www.candou.com/mobile/2012-04-13/444574_all.shtml《主流智能手机CPU型号性能点评》原创 2012-11-05 17:18:35 · 1325 阅读 · 0 评论 -
Android准备往OpenWrt上移植
原创作品,转载请注明原作者及地址!by 飞鸿惊雪http://blog.youkuaiyun.com/niyufengAndroid准备往OpenWrt上移植这两天全力编译android,cpu 4个线程全开,磁盘大吞吐的存取,导致温度过高,编译中间笔记本保护性质的自动休眠关机。不说废话,进入正题。友善的mini6410自带的是andro原创 2012-10-26 05:49:44 · 9620 阅读 · 2 评论 -
编译移植android 2.3到tiny210
原创作品,转载请注明原作者及地址!by 飞鸿惊雪这两天玩android,做个小结吧。避免麻烦,直接从nfs启动,下面是我常用的几个参数。1 从nfs启动android (tiny210自带的android根文件系统,使用自己稍加修改编译好的tiny210自带kernel,自己编译的uboot启动)。使用下面的bootargs:console=ttySAC原创 2012-10-26 04:52:36 · 2976 阅读 · 2 评论 -
android工具链与GNU工具链的比较
Android所用的Toolchain(即交叉编译工具链)可从下面的网址下载:http://android.kernel.org/pub/android-toolchain-20081019.tar.bz2如果下载了完整的Android项目的源代码,则可以在prebuilt/linux-x86/toolchain/arm-eabi-4.2.1/bin目录下找到交叉编译工具,比如Androi原创 2012-10-26 03:54:31 · 2532 阅读 · 0 评论 -
Android源代码结构分析
Android源代码结构分析Google提供的Android包含了:Android源代码,工具链,基础C库,仿真环境,开发环境等,完整的一套。第一级别的目录和文件如下所示:----------------├── Makefile 全局的Makefile├── build 系统编译规则和配置所需要的脚本和工具------原创 2012-10-24 04:21:39 · 16924 阅读 · 4 评论 -
Android4.0与Android2.3源代码差异
http://blog.youkuaiyun.com/andyhuabing/article/details/7095834=======================================================================================================其实一句话就搞定了:谷歌新一代Android 4.0系统拥有全新设原创 2012-10-06 19:49:55 · 1181 阅读 · 0 评论 -
查看Android源码版本
有时候我们辛苦取到Android的源代码,想知道它的确切版本号,比如有时候我们只粗略知道拿到的是2.3的源码,但并不明确他的小版本号,这就是有时候明明都是2.3的代码可比较起来还是有差异的原因,比方说一个是2.3.1,而一个是2.3.4;确认的方法很简单:1. 编译的时候在终端中一开始就会打印出来:PLATFORM_VERSION:2.3.12. 直接去make文件中去看:原创 2012-10-23 14:28:32 · 1406 阅读 · 0 评论 -
android中使用local_manifest.xml添加软件
http://www.freedesktop.org/wiki/Software/PulseAudio/Ports/Android 中有使用local_manifest.xml来添加PulseAudio的实例,其中local_manifest.xml已经写好了:wget http://people.collabora.com/~arun/android/local_manifest.xm原创 2012-10-22 22:56:00 · 2952 阅读 · 0 评论 -
Android的SDK,NDK以及JNI
1 SDK(software development kit)软件开发工具包。被软件开发工程师用于为特定的软件包、软件框架、硬件平台、操作系统等建立应用软件的开发工具的集合。因此!Android SDK指的既是Android专属的软件开发工具包。可以说只要你使用java去开发Android这个东西就必须用到。他包含了SDK Manager 和 AVD Manage 对于androi原创 2012-10-05 21:16:12 · 1487 阅读 · 0 评论 -
Ubuntu安装JDK6和JDK5
在安装android on openwrt是出现错误:build/core/config.mk:271: *** Error: could not find jdk tools.jar, please install JDK6, which you can download from java.sun.com. Stop.需要安装JDK6!一 第一种方法:原创 2012-09-08 08:56:11 · 14338 阅读 · 1 评论 -
尝试编译android-2.3.7_r1
在参考别人的编译记录时,经常会看到如下的修改:由于我们是32位系统,所以有些文件需要修改一下:将./build/core/main.mk 中的ifneq (64,$(findstring64,$(build_arch)))改为:ifneq (i686,$(findstring i686,$(build_arch)))将android-2.3.7_r1/externa原创 2012-10-05 18:56:55 · 1918 阅读 · 0 评论 -
尝试编译android-4.0.4_r2.1
这几天第一次尝试编译andorid,顺利编译了android-4.0.4_r2.1和android-2.3.7_r1,这两个分别是4.0和2.3的最后版本。也尝试编译最新的android-4.1.1_r6,但是没成功,好像android-4.1要求要在64位的系统上编译,而我的32位系统上编译没多长时间就出错了。CPU:Intel® Pentium(R) Dual CPU E2180原创 2012-10-04 19:11:10 · 5848 阅读 · 0 评论 -
编译Android时出现make: execvp: /bin/bash: Argument list too long错误
http://web.nchu.edu.tw/~jlu/cyut/android/build21.shtmlhttp://hi.baidu.com/pxdhkeiuajbglpd/item/ff2347e559a006f82a09a4b8上述方法实际上是把Android.mk重写了,分别链接成几个子lib,然后在合并为一个整体的lib!原创 2012-09-12 13:44:15 · 6009 阅读 · 0 评论 -
移植android的工作环境
Android的源代码可以在source.android.com网站获取,Android的Linux Kernel源代码同样可以在source.android.com取得。Android源代码大约占用2.1GB磁盘空间,而编译Android系统则至少需要6GB磁盘空间。安装上面一些必要的软件程序:sudo apt-get install原创 2012-09-08 17:37:01 · 1593 阅读 · 0 评论 -
OpenWrt上运行Android OS
Advanced configuration options (for developers) --->选择Show broken platforms / packages:Target System --->选择Goldfish (Android Emulator):Hardware --->选择goldf原创 2012-09-08 23:32:41 · 4122 阅读 · 0 评论 -
对于android2.3源代码的相关修改
《android系统开发(五)-tslib移植》 http://blog.youkuaiyun.com/jiajie961/article/details/6005488《Android系统移植 之 touch》 http://hi.baidu.com/twkgyxibqgbckmd/item/affc4d30ead5cb4d3175a1c7《触摸屏的校准方法》 http://mxpop原创 2012-11-13 11:45:54 · 2932 阅读 · 0 评论